Police Investigating Stabbing in Great Mills

October 3, 2017

UPDATE 10/3/2017 @ 10:oo a.m. – Official St. Mary’s County Sheriff’s Office Press Release: On 10/2/17, at approximately 8:39 P.M., deputies responded to the 45000 block of Foxchase Drive in Great Mills for a report of an assault.

Contact was made with an individual who sustained a minor laceration to their hand.

The victim was transported to MedStar St. Mary’s Hospital for treatment. The investigation is continuing and is being handled by Cpl. Reppel #141.
